Understand the Fundamentals of Mindfulness

What is Mindfulness?

Mindfulness is the practice of being fully present and engaged in the current moment, aware of your thoughts, feelings, and surroundings without judgment. It involves paying attention intentionally, which can enhance your ability to respond thoughtfully rather than react impulsively.

Benefits of Mindful Living

  • Reduced Stress: Mindfulness helps lower cortisol levels, reducing stress and anxiety.
  • Improved Focus: Enhances concentration and cognitive function.
  • Emotional Regulation: Aids in managing emotions and increasing emotional intelligence.
  • Better Relationships: Promotes empathy and effective communication.
  • Enhanced Well-being: Contributes to overall mental and physical health.

Incorporate Mindful Practices into Daily Life

Start Your Day with Mindfulness

Begin each day with a few minutes of mindfulness meditation. Sit quietly, focus on your breath, and set positive intentions for the day ahead. This practice can center your mind and prepare you to handle daily challenges with calmness.

Mindful Eating

Pay attention to the flavors, textures, and aromas of your food. Eating slowly and savoring each bite can improve digestion, prevent overeating, and enhance your appreciation for meals. Avoid distractions like TV or smartphones during meals to stay present.

Practice Deep Breathing

In moments of stress or anxiety, deep breathing exercises can help you regain composure. Try the 4-7-8 technique: inhale for 4 seconds, hold for 7 seconds, and exhale for 8 seconds. This method can activate your relaxation response and reduce tension.

Engage in Mindful Movement

Incorporate activities like yoga, tai chi, or walking meditation into your routine. These practices combine physical movement with mindful awareness, promoting both physical and mental well-being.

Create a Mindful Environment

Declutter Your Space

According to KEA Home tidy environment can enhance mental clarity and reduce stress. Regularly declutter your living and workspaces to create a calm and organized atmosphere that supports mindful living.

Surround Yourself with Nature

Spending time in natural settings can boost your mood and foster a sense of peace. Whether it's a walk in the park, gardening, or simply enjoying fresh air, connecting with nature enhances mindfulness.

Limit Digital Distractions

Set boundaries for technology use to prevent overwhelm and distraction. Allocate specific times for checking emails and social media, and create tech-free zones in your home to encourage presence and interaction.

Foster Mindful Relationships

Active Listening

Practice fully listening to others without interrupting or planning your response. Active listening demonstrates respect and fosters deeper connections, enhancing the quality of your relationships.

Express Gratitude

Regularly acknowledge and appreciate the people in your life. Expressing gratitude can strengthen bonds and cultivate a positive outlook, contributing to a balanced and fulfilling life.

Set Healthy Boundaries

Establish clear boundaries to protect your time and energy. Communicate your needs assertively and respect others' boundaries to maintain healthy and harmonious relationships.

Develop a Mindful Mindset

Embrace Imperfection

Accept that mistakes and imperfections are part of life. Cultivating self-compassion and letting go of perfectionism can reduce stress and enhance your ability to navigate challenges gracefully.

Practice Letting Go

Release negative thoughts and emotions that no longer serve you. Mindfulness encourages you to acknowledge these feelings without attachment, allowing you to move forward with greater ease.

Cultivate Patience

Developing patience helps you handle delays and frustrations with calmness. Mindfulness teaches you to stay present and patient, fostering resilience in the face of adversity.

Integrate Mindfulness into Work and Productivity

Prioritize Tasks

Use mindfulness to prioritize your tasks based on importance and urgency. Focus on one task at a time, avoiding multitasking to enhance efficiency and reduce overwhelm.

Take Regular Breaks

Incorporate short breaks into your workday to rest and recharge. Use these moments to stretch, breathe deeply, or meditate, which can boost productivity and prevent burnout.

Create a Mindful Workspace

Design a workspace that promotes focus and tranquility. Personalize your area with calming elements like plants, soothing colors, and minimal clutter to support mindful work habits.
